What is a Time Capsule used for?
A time capsule is a historic cache of goods or information, usually intended as a deliberate method of communication with future people, and to help future archaeologists, anthropologists, or historians.
What does a Time Capsule have?
A Time Capsule is a combination of an AirPort Extreme and an external hard drive, and comes in 2 TB or 3 TB. It automatically backs up all Macs on your network. Is Apple Time Capsule still supported?
Even though Apple discontinued the Time Capsule in 2018, the product is still in use by many Mac users, and a flaw in the Seagate drive inside could put data at risk. The news was first reported by the German data recovery company Datenrettung Berlin (via Golem).

What can I do with an old apple Time Capsule?
It is primarily designed to perform as a router but also to be the backup destination for Time Machine. You can also attach a USB hard drive and/or USB printer to the Time Capsule and share them over the network to other clients.

What was the size of the 1939 World’s Fair Time Capsule?
The 1939 New York World’s Fair time capsule was created by Westinghouse as part of their exhibit. It was 90 inches (2.3 metres) long, with an interior diameter of 6.5 inches (16 cm), and weighed 800 pounds (360 kg).
What was the first time capsule ever opened?
Background. The Crypt of Civilization (1936) at Oglethorpe University, intended to be opened in 8113, is generally regarded as the first modern time capsule, although it was not called one at the time.
